TOLEDO__The visiting Bluffton High School boys basketball team exploded for a big second half to pull away and decisively defeat Ottawa Hills 64-37 in Div. V Northwest 2 sectional final play on Friday, February 27.
The first half was low-scoring, with the Pirates ahead 21-15 at intermission. A 19-9 Bluffton third period extended their lead to 40-24 heading to the final period.
CANTON – Bluffton High School senior swimmer Jackson Bowlus competed well in two finals races at the Div. II state meet in Canton’s C.T. Branin Natatorium on Friday evening, February 27.
Pirate ace Bowlus earned All-Ohio honors by making it to the podium in the 100-yard backstroke event.
CANTON – Five Bluffton High School swimmers competed well at the Div. II Ohio state meet preliminary round in Canton’s C.T. Branin Natatorium on Thursday evening, February 26.
Pirate senior ace Jackson Bowlus advanced to a pair of finals raceson Friday evening. Bowlus finished sixth in the 32-swimmer 100 backstroke field in 52.66, an improvement of .60 over his district time. He qualified for the A Finals on Friday evening by being one of the top nine swimmers.
